What to Count on from Your Las Vegas Realtor: A Buyer’s Guide

Posted on July 12, 2025 by hugo092581 Posted in business .

Buying a home in Las Vegas is a major investment, and partnering with the correct realtor can make all of the difference in your experience. Whether you are relocating, investing, or buying your dream home, a qualified Las Vegas realtor plays a critical position in serving to you navigate the fast-paced and competitive market. Here’s what you’ll be able to count on out of your Las Vegas realtor and methods to make the many of the partnership.

Local Market Experience

Las Vegas is a singular real estate market with speedy progress, numerous neighborhoods, and fluctuating property values. A professional realtor should have deep knowledge of local trends, pricing, and inventory. They’ll be able to advise you on up-and-coming areas, school districts, property taxes, and neighborhood amenities. Whether you are looking for a luxury home in Summerlin, a family-friendly property in Henderson, or a high-rise condo near The Strip, your agent should tailor their recommendations to your needs and lifestyle.

Personalized Property Search

Your realtor should take the time to understand your goals, budget, and preferences earlier than curating a list of properties. This includes narrowing down options primarily based on location, measurement, style, proximity to work or entertainment, and long-term value. In a market as competitive as Las Vegas, the place homes can go under contract quickly, your agent must also set up instant alerts for new listings and assist you view homes as quickly as they hit the market.

Skilled Negotiation

One of the vital valuable services your Las Vegas realtor provides is skilled negotiation. In competitive situations, a robust negotiator will help you win the bid without overpaying. Your agent ought to have a clear strategy, understand the seller’s motivations, and guide you on crafting compelling offers. This contains negotiating worth, closing costs, contingencies, and timelines to protect your interests while keeping the deal attractive to the seller.

Professional Networking

Experienced realtors in Las Vegas have a stable network of business professionals—mortgage brokers, inspectors, contractors, title corporations, and real estate attorneys. Your agent should recommend trusted partners to ensure a smooth and secure transaction from start to finish. Having a reliable team behind you can help keep away from delays, uncover potential property issues early, and expedite the shopping for process.

Steerage Via the Buying Process

From pre-approval to closing day, your realtor ought to act as your advocate and advisor every step of the way. They’ll help you put together documentation, submit offers, coordinate inspections, evaluation disclosures, and communicate with all parties involved. Las Vegas transactions can contain unique considerations, particularly if you happen to’re buying new construction or investing briefly-term rental properties. A great realtor will make sure you understand every aspect of the deal and make informed decisions.

Knowledge of Market Rules

The Las Vegas housing market features a range of properties, together with single-family homes, townhouses, condos, and units within HOAs or gated communities. Your realtor must be familiar with local rules and laws, zoning restrictions, HOA requirements, and any tax implications that may have an effect on your purchase. This is particularly necessary in the event you’re an out-of-state purchaser or investor unfamiliar with Nevada’s real estate laws.

Clear Communication and Accessibility

It’s best to count on prompt and clear communication from your realtor throughout the homeshopping for journey. In a fast-paced market like Las Vegas, delays in communication can mean missed opportunities. A very good agent will keep you informed, reply your questions, and be available whenever you want help—even throughout evenings or weekends.

Final Tip

Selecting the best Las Vegas realtor is essential to finding the fitting home and avoiding pointless stress. Look for someone who is just not only licensed and skilled but also attentive, responsive, and genuinely interested in helping you succeed. An excellent realtor will make the process smoother, protect your investment, and assist you settle into your new home with confidence.
